Paměť CiscoEnchancedMemPool ExcessiveFragmentation

System.NetworkManagement.CiscoEnchancedMemPool.Memory.ExcessiveFragmentation (UnitMonitor)

Sleduje největší volnou procentní hodnotu vyrovnávací paměti v tomto zařízení

Knowledge Base article:

Souhrn

Monitorování indikuje úroveň fragmentace paměti v tomto fondu paměti. Toto monitorování má dva možné stavy:

Konfigurace

V tomto monitorování lze nastavit následující možnosti:

Možnost

Definice

Výchozí

Interval

Množství času v sekundách mezi kontrolami stavu zařízení

240 sekund

Počet opakovaných pokusů

Počet pokusů v každém intervalu monitorování, než bude vzorek intervalu zahozen

3

Počet vzorků

Počet následných vzorků, než monitorování změní stav

3

Časový limit

Čas v milisekundách, jak dlouho se má čekat na odpověď od zařízení, než vyprší časový limit vzorku a bude učiněn nový pokus o sběr vzorku hodnot

3 500 milisekund

Prahová hodnota

Největší podíl volné vyrovnávací paměti, pod nějž je paměť považována za fragmentovanou

10

Příčiny

Toto monitorování nastaví stav chyby, pokud je systémová paměť v tomto zařízení silně fragmentovaná. Největší podíl volné vyrovnávací paměti je porovnán s prahovou hodnotou (výchozí prahová hodnota je 10). Největší podíl volné vyrovnávací paměti je vypočítán na základě největší souvislé části vyrovnávací paměti ve fondu a porovnání s volnou paměti zbývající ve fondu.

Řešení

Pomocí průzkumníka stavů zkontrolujte podrobnosti ke změně stavu na kartě Události změny stavu pro monitorování. Tato data zobrazují největší změřený podíl volné vyrovnávací paměti, který způsobil změnu stavu. Další informace o problému a postupech k jeho řešení vyhledejte v dokumentaci výrobce zařízení.

Element properties:

TargetSystem.NetworkManagement.CiscoEnchancedMemPool_Performance_Memory
Parent MonitorSystem.NetworkManagement.Memory.MemoryException
CategoryPerformanceHealth
EnabledTrue
Alert GenerateTrue
Alert SeverityMatchMonitorHealth
Alert PriorityNormal
Alert Auto ResolveTrue
Monitor TypeSystem.NetworkManagement.ComputedExcessiveFragmentationMonitorType
RemotableTrue
AccessibilityPublic
Alert Message
Výstraha nadměrné fragmentace paměti
Největší volná vyrovnávací paměť na {0} je pod prahovou hodnotou. Největší volná vyrovnávací paměť je {1}\% z celkové volné paměti.
RunAsDefault

Source Code:

<UnitMonitor ID="System.NetworkManagement.CiscoEnchancedMemPool.Memory.ExcessiveFragmentation" Accessibility="Public" Enabled="true" Target="NetworkLibrary!System.NetworkManagement.CiscoEnchancedMemPool_Performance_Memory" ParentMonitorID="System.NetworkManagement.Memory.MemoryException" Remotable="true" Priority="Normal" TypeID="System.NetworkManagement.ComputedExcessiveFragmentationMonitorType" ConfirmDelivery="false">
<Category>PerformanceHealth</Category>
<AlertSettings AlertMessage="System.NetworkManagement.Generic.Memory.ExcessiveFragmentation.AlertMessage">
<AlertOnState>Error</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>Normal</AlertPriority>
<AlertSeverity>MatchMonitorHealth</AlertSeverity>
<AlertParameters>
<AlertParameter1>$Target/Host/Property[Type="System!System.Entity"]/DisplayName$</AlertParameter1>
<AlertParameter2>$Data/Context/Value$</AlertParameter2>
</AlertParameters>
</AlertSettings>
<OperationalStates>
<OperationalState ID="OverThreshold" MonitorTypeStateID="MTSThresholdError" HealthState="Error"/>
<OperationalState ID="UnderThreshold" MonitorTypeStateID="MTSThresholdSuccess" HealthState="Success"/>
</OperationalStates>
<Configuration>
<Interval>300</Interval>
<NoOfRetries>3</NoOfRetries>
<Timeout>3500</Timeout>
<LargestFreeBufferOID>.1.3.6.1.4.1.9.9.221.1.1.1.1.9.$Target/Property[Type="NetworkLibrary!System.NetworkManagement.LogicalDevice"]/Index$</LargestFreeBufferOID>
<FreeMemoryOID>.1.3.6.1.4.1.9.9.221.1.1.1.1.8.$Target/Property[Type="NetworkLibrary!System.NetworkManagement.LogicalDevice"]/Index$</FreeMemoryOID>
<ValidMemoryOID>.1.3.6.1.4.1.9.9.221.1.1.1.1.6.$Target/Property[Type="NetworkLibrary!System.NetworkManagement.LogicalDevice"]/Index$</ValidMemoryOID>
<ValidMemoryRegEx>^1$</ValidMemoryRegEx>
<Threshold>10</Threshold>
<NumberOfSamples>3</NumberOfSamples>
<ObjectName>Memory</ObjectName>
<CounterName>Largest Free Buffer %</CounterName>
</Configuration>
</UnitMonitor>